Hi, I would like to create a Moose model of a VisualAge smalltalk application. I tried to fileout a bunch of applications (which are groups of packages as far as I understood) and the result file .app has naturally a different syntax from pharo st files. Now, the questions are:
- Should I customize the PPSmalltalkParser or should I start a parser from scratch? - Did anybody tried to import in moose a smalltalk dilect different from pharo? If yes how did he do that?
I just want to understand if I can save time or I should build a whole parser and importer from scratch.
Thanks for any suggestion or information.
Cheers, Fabriyio (bloodz german kezboard)
Hi Fabrizio,
I think you have two strategies:
1. Build the importer in VA and export MSE This is way we are dealing with VW: use the importer in VW and export the MSE file. This was because we already had the importer and FAMIX in VW.
2. Build a dedicated Parser and importer As you suggested, you could build a parser. I guess that the syntax is not (much) different. In this case, I would build a surrounding parser that deals with the specifics of the .st file and uses PPSmalltalkParser for the actual method parsing. Given that the Pharo importer already uses the RB AST, perhaps you can directly make the parser to instantiate RB AST nodes.
I would rather favor the second option. If we go in this direction, we could also make it so that the Smalltalk importing infrastructure is flexible enough to only require different parsers.

The Importer has two parts: - The SmalltalkImporter deals with all classes. It has these create* and ensure* methods to deal with creating the actual entities. For this to work, it needs a Pharo model. For example, in createClass, you ensure the associated package, but this is based on the RPackage model. - The visiting of method ASTs happens in the SmalltalkMethodVisitor which is triggered by SmalltalkImporter>>createMethod:. It is this visitor which is the responsible for triggering the creation of low-level objects like invocations and accesses.
As I see it, you would probably benefit from subclassing both of these classes to deal with your input model and ASTs. In the future, perhaps we can generalize a bit the infrastructure to handle your case without dirty overrides.

Yes but what is so different in VA Smalltalk code?
Well, so far I saw that:
- methods can be private or public (eventhough I think at the end they all have a public scope) - there are 4 different ways to define classes: e.g.: String *variableByteSubclass:* #MyString classVariableNames: '' poolDictionaries: '' (and instanceVariableNames: is missing)
or:
AClass *variableSubclass:* #AnotherClass instanceVariableNames: '' classVariableNames: '' poolDictionaries: ''
- another think I never saw and was not part of the parse for methods was the pool dictionary access (but this should be the same in pharo I think): Class::AnotherClass!!variable for this I had to subclass the method parser - another think I never saw but it might be the static array stuff you mentioned is: mapAspect: aString | map | map := *##*(Dictionary new at: 'Numberblabla' put: blablabla; at: 'BLABLABLA' put: MyConstants::ContantClass; yourself ). ^map at: aString
To parse this I added a unary operator ## followed by an expression. - There is class extension not package extension - There are no packages or categories only applications(which are like packages): an application contains classes, can depend from other applications and can be use in class extension (so you say to a class that it is extended by a certain application). From the the point of view of the class you see the application that extend the class and from an application point of view you see the extended classes.
So far this what was new from VA.
When you file out an application (or a set of them) you get a file.app. The syntax of this file is very similar to the st one but of course you need to consider most od the peculiaritis I wrote before (e.g. variableSubclass: etc.).
The parser for the app file btw is done (pretty much). I extended some elements of RB like RBMethod and RBClass and I had to add other AST node for elements that are not present normaly in st file like for example class context switch line: (!MyClass class publicMethods !) after which there are all class side public methods of MyClass and stuff like that.

the importing context is an object that implements a coherent view on an extracted model. The idea is that you should not import accesses if you do not import variable. So the importing context manages such dependencies and the user just configures the importing context and the importer will follow the dependencies graph represented by the importing context.
The importer always ask shouldIImport…. to the importingContext.

Hi,
SmalltalkImporter gets as input a collection of classes. Based on these class objects, it creates the structural entities up to the level of methods. To build the entities that reside at the level of method bodies, The SmalltalkMethodVisitor is used and this traverses the RB AST. The RB AST is only used in the SmalltalkMethodVisitor.
But, if you want to get more details, you could: - put a self halt in createMethod: - run LANImporterTest>>testClassName - and then step through the execution :)
